Do release build and simply job names

This commit is contained in:
Felix Krull 2018-10-16 18:48:35 +02:00 committed by Colin Walters
parent 527e1b4b4d
commit fea0a7d807

View File

@ -9,19 +9,31 @@ stages:
- build - build
- package - package
libostree-sys_rust-stable: libostree-sys:
stage: build stage: build
script: script:
- cargo build --verbose --package libostree-sys - cargo build --verbose --package libostree-sys
- cargo test --verbose --package libostree-sys - cargo test --verbose --package libostree-sys
libostree_rust-stable: libostree-sys_release:
stage: build
script:
- cargo build --verbose --release --package libostree-sys
- cargo test --verbose --release --package libostree-sys
libostree:
stage: build stage: build
script: script:
- cargo build --verbose --package libostree - cargo build --verbose --package libostree
- cargo test --verbose --package libostree - cargo test --verbose --package libostree
libostree-sys_rust-nightly: libostree_release:
stage: build
script:
- cargo build --verbose --release --package libostree
- cargo test --verbose --release --package libostree
libostree-sys_nightly:
stage: build stage: build
image: rustlang/rust:nightly image: rustlang/rust:nightly
script: script:
@ -29,7 +41,7 @@ libostree-sys_rust-nightly:
- cargo test --verbose --package libostree-sys - cargo test --verbose --package libostree-sys
allow_failure: true allow_failure: true
libostree_rust-nightly: libostree_nightly:
stage: build stage: build
image: rustlang/rust:nightly image: rustlang/rust:nightly
script: script: